Ditch Digging in Houston, TX
Ditch digging services involve the excavation of trenches or holes in the ground to support a variety of property projects. Common uses include installing or repairing underground utilities such as water lines, sewer systems, or electrical cables, as well as preparing foundations for fences, retaining walls, or landscaping features.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of the excavation work, the depth and width of the trenches, and any potential impact on existing structures or landscaping before requesting this service.
Before requesting ditch digging, homeowners should consider the location of underground utilities to avoid accidental damage, as well as any permits or regulations that may apply to excavation work in their area. It’s also helpful to know the approximate size and purpose of the project, so the service provider can assess the necessary equipment and scope of work. Clear communication about these details can help ensure the project proceeds smoothly and meets the specific needs of the property.

Common Ditch Digging Jobs
Drainage Installation - excavation services for installing new drain pipes to prevent water pooling.
Sewer Line Replacement - replacing damaged or aging sewer lines to ensure proper waste removal.
Foundation Drainage - creating drainage systems around foundations to reduce water pressure and prevent damage.
Utility Line Trenching - digging trenches for underground utility lines such as water, gas, or electrical cables.
Landscape Drainage Solutions - installing French drains or surface drains to manage excess surface water.
Yard Drainage Improvements - grading and trenching to direct water away from structures and landscaped areas.
Ditch Digging Questions
What types of projects require ditch digging? Ditch digging is often used for installing drainage systems, utility lines, irrigation, or foundation drainage around properties.
How deep can a ditch be dug? The depth of a ditch depends on the project requirements, typically ranging from a few inches to several feet.
What should property owners consider before digging a ditch? It's important to identify underground utilities and ensure proper permits are obtained before starting the work.
Is ditch digging suitable for small or large properties? Ditch digging can be adapted for both small residential yards and larger property projects based on the scope needed.
